Cleveland Cavaliers guard Dwayne Wade may be an NBA star, but off the court he’s a true family man,
Wade is showing support for his wife of three years, actress Gabrielle Union, after she publicly revealed their years-long struggle to have a baby.

Union wrote in her new book, “We’re Going to Need More Wine,” that she has suffered from several miscarriages.
“I have had eight or nine miscarriages,” Union wrote in the book, which was excerpted in People. “For three years, my body has been a prisoner of trying to get pregnant — I’ve either been about to go into an IVF cycle, in the middle of an IVF cycle, or coming out of an IVF cycle.”
After People published the excerpt, Wade, 35, wrote on Twitter that his wife “is one strong individual!!!”

Union plays stepmother to Wade’s three boys from his previous marriage – ages 16, 15 and 10. She said the joy she felt in helping to raise them made her realize that she wanted a baby of her own.
“I never wanted kids,” Union told People. “Then, I became a stepmom, and there was no place I’d rather be than with them.”
Earlier this year, Union described the chaotic life that comes with being parents to three burgeoning athletes.
“What we didn’t anticipate becoming were sports parents,” Union told Steve Harvey in February. “We’re those parents who give half-time lectures in the middle of the game … we’re those people.”
While Union, 44, has spoken about her troubles with IVF in the past, she wrote that she and Wade “remain bursting with love and ready to do anything to meet the child we’ve both dreamed of.”
Union’s book is scheduled to be released on Oct. 17.
